Repair Old Akai VCR plays FF/REW fine but tape won't move during PLAY — belt issue?
Hey everyone, I've got an old Akai VS-P8EV MKII VHS player that sat unused for years, and I'm trying to fix a weird issue.
Here's what's happening:
- Fast forward and rewind both work totally fine — tape moves, reels spin, no problem.
- But when I hit PLAY, the tape just... doesn't move. It stays stuck on one frame.
- I checked and the spinning head drum (the part that reads the video) is spinning normally even during play.
- Sometimes it also just shuts itself off a second or two after I press play.
Since FF and REW work but PLAY doesn't move the tape at all, I'm guessing the problem is with whatever pulls the tape past the heads specifically during play — I think that's called the capstan and pinch roller. From what I understand, FF/REW spin the reels directly, but PLAY relies on a different part (capstan + rubber pinch roller) to pull the tape through at a steady speed, and that seems to be the part not working.
My guess is either:
- the rubber belt that drives this part has stretched out or snapped (very common in old VCRs), or
- the little rubber roller that presses the tape against the spinning shaft isn't pressing properly anymore, or has gone hard/slippery with age
Has anyone dealt with this before? A few questions:
Does this sound like a classic belt/roller problem to you?
Any tips on how to find/see this belt on an Akai deck like this? I opened the case a bit but couldn't clearly spot it.
Do generic "universal VCR belt kits" from online stores usually work for old decks like this, or do I need to hunt for exact Akai parts?
